48#ifndef _CFE_VENDOR_IOCB_H
49#define _CFE_VENDOR_IOCB_H
50
51/*  *********************************************************************
52    *  Constants
53    ********************************************************************* */
54
55#define CFE_CMD_VENDOR_SAMPLE	(CFE_CMD_VENDOR_USE+0)
56
57#define CFE_CMD_VENDOR_MAX	(CFE_CMD_VENDOR_USE+1)
58
59
60/*  *********************************************************************
61    *  Structures
62    ********************************************************************* */
63
64/*
65 * Vendor note: The fields in this structure leading up to the
66 * union *must* match the ones in cfe_iocb.h
67 *
68 * You can declare your own parameter list members here, since
69 * only your functions will be using them.
70 */
71
72
73typedef struct cfe_vendor_iocb_s {
74    cfe_uint_t iocb_fcode;		/* IOCB function code */
75    cfe_int_t  iocb_status;		/* return status */
76    cfe_int_t  iocb_handle;		/* file/device handle */
77    cfe_uint_t iocb_flags;		/* flags for this IOCB */
78    cfe_uint_t iocb_psize;		/* size of parameter list */
79    union {
80	/* add/replace parameter list here */
81	iocb_buffer_t  iocb_buffer;	/* buffer parameters */
82    } plist;
83} cfe_vendor_iocb_t;
84
85
86#endif
